When Iheoma U. Iruka was a child, she knew she wanted to help people like her mom, who worked three jobs and was never home. Skip to her years of graduate studies, and Iheoma U. Iruka is now a research professor at the UNC-Chapel Hill Department of Public Policy and founding director of the Equity Research Action Coalition within the Frank Porter Graham Child Development Institute. She studies how to promote health, wealth, and educational excellence of minoritized children and children from low-income households.

When asked to describe her research in 5 words, Iruka said, “Early childhood equity is justice.”
